javascript - Bagaimana untuk menyediakan fail konfigurasi yang boleh diubah suai oleh operasi dan penyelenggaraan untuk projek bahagian hadapan yang disusun oleh webpack?
巴扎黑
巴扎黑 2017-05-19 10:15:02
0
2
461

Projek perlu menggunakan pemalar url, yang mungkin berubah mengikut keadaan operasi dan penyelenggaraan sebenar.
Sekarang apabila URL berubah, saya perlu menukar kod sumber dan menyusun semula.
Jika anda tidak menggunakan pek web, masalah ini tidak akan berlaku Hanya beritahu operasi dan penyelenggaraan laluan ke fail konfigurasi.
Tetapi apabila menggunakan webpack, adakah terdapat cara untuk mengelakkan situasi ini dan membenarkan operasi dan penyelenggaraan mengubah suai konfigurasi?

巴扎黑
巴扎黑

membalas semua(2)
我想大声告诉你

Letakkan item konfigurasi secara berasingan dalam json, dan baca konfigurasi dalam json ini dahulu semasa menjalankan projek.

  • Anda boleh memuatkan fail json ini melalui ajax/xhr/fetch/amd, terdapat banyak cara

  • Pada masa ini, kami perlu mempertimbangkan isu prestasi Gunakan cache/cookie/localStorage dengan baik supaya anda tidak perlu memuat semula fail json setiap kali.

我想大声告诉你

Pendekatan projek kami adalah untuk mengkonfigurasi berbilang fail konfigurasi untuk pembangunan, ujian dan pengeluaran

Persekitaran berbeza menggunakan konfigurasi berbeza

Muat turun terkini
Lagi>
kesan web
Kod sumber laman web
Bahan laman web
Templat hujung hadapan